Overcoming binge eating can be really difficult. As well as any type of Eating Disorder. And yes, binge eating is a type of eating disorder. What you should do, is set a daily meal plan. Include filling, yet HEALTHY foods. Such as things that are high in fiber. Include lots of fruits and vegies in your meal plan. It will really help. And honestly, if you feel like binging, fill up on fruits and vegies..because they're healthy. But the important thing is getting you out of your rituals and habits. Another thing you should consider doing is seeing a nutritionist. They can plan a healthy diet for you that you're comfortable with. The only thing you have to do is follow it. And that can be extremely difficult. But things like this take effort. And Rome wasn't built in a day. ;] Take care.
